  • Learn the art of magic with this easy video tutorial that teaches you how to perform an impressive card trick using only 15 cards. This self-working trick is perfect for beginners and requires no sleight of hand or prior knowledge of magic. In just a few simple steps, you'll be able to amaze your friends and family with this mind-blowing illusion.
    In this video, you'll discover a secret method for manipulating the cards in a way that creates the illusion that you find the spectator's card, even though you are seemingly mixing the cards. The trick involves asking the spectator to freely select a card from the deck, and you magically identify that exact card without any further information. With clear instructions and easy-to-follow visuals, this video will guide you through every step of the process, ensuring that you can master this trick with ease.
